Multiple mini-festivals within a large event to make Vh1 Supersonic 2023 special: Gaurav Mashruwala of Viacom18 Live

The multi-genre music and lifestyle festival, Vh1 Supersonic edition 2023, is returning after three years with an aim to give a new experience to all music lovers and lifestyle enthusiasts. 

It is slated to be held between February 24-26 at Pune's Mahalakshmi Lawns. 

publive-image
Gaurav Mashruwala

In an exclusive conversation with BestMediaInfo.com, Gaurav Mashruwala, Business Head, Viacom18 Live (Integrated Network Solutions), said that since Supersonic is making a comeback after three years, it is going to have multiple mini-festivals within a large festival and transcend genres, cuisines, artists and experiences.

What’s new in Vh1 Supersonic edition 2023?

Artist line-up

Mashruwala said that Vh1 Supersonic is returning after a long gap and, therefore, it was very essential to keep its soul the same as earlier editions.

“However, over the last two-and-a-half years the way people are consuming content has changed dramatically. So, keeping all these things in mind, we have done a few things. One is our artist line-up, people today are discovering music through a lot of social media platforms be it Instagram, TikTok or others, so we have brought in our headliners who are excellent with their music and are also very popular on social media,” Mashruwala stated. 

“Which is why you see Tyga, Anne-Marie, and CKay as some of our headliners for this festival. Along with that, as the trend in music is changing and we are seeing that a lot of people are now listening to hip-hop music, we have also added some big Indian hip-hop/ rap names like Divine, ‘Seedhe Maut’ and obviously, Tyga is also a hip-hop sensation. Keeping this in mind we keep evolving music-wise to be on point and keep up with the trend,” he added. 

BUDX Spectrum Stage-House of techno music

Furthermore, he went on to say that there has been a change in the way people are consuming electronic dance music (EDM) and the change is moving towards house and techno. 

“So, we are launching a stage in collaboration with Budweiser - called the BUDX Spectrum Stage. This will be our house of techno music where people can enjoy techno music as well as the house and dance music that people like to enjoy these days. Therein, we have brought in our headliners like CamelPhat and Bob Moses which go to the tune of our spectrum phenomena,” Mashruwala added.

3D stage show

“We have also seen that people are interested in immersive experiences. Innellea, one of the artists, will actually be doing a 3D show on stage. This will be a really good experience for most people who come to the festival,” Mashruwala said.

Super Street on a larger scale

Mashruwala said, “Continuing on the line of experiences, in our last edition we launched Super Street which is our fashion and art experience. In the last edition, it was small, we had close to about 35-40 young and upcoming artists and designers showcasing. This time we have tied up with Sunday Soul Sante to be our fashion partner on Super Street and NRYTA to be our art partner. Together they will bring over 100 young and upcoming designers both in the art and fashion space to showcase their wear.”

Food and beverages

“Besides that, for food and drinks, we have tied up with Impresario Entertainment and Hospitality. They will be now curating our entire super flea. They will bring in the best of the restaurant pop-ups. They will also bring in their professional bartenders who will curate cocktails,” Mashruwala said.

He continued by saying that this has now become a multi-genre music and lifestyle festival and people will also see smaller festivals within a large festival – be it a fashion festival or art festival, or even a food and beverage festival. 

“So, I would say we have one plus three kinds of experience now at Supersonic,” he added.

Challenges faced in bringing back Vh1 Supersonic post-pandemic

According to Mashruwala, the biggest challenge to bringing back Vh1 Supersonic has been the pandemic itself.

“During the pandemic both India, as well as different countries, had their own ups and downs. Each country came up with their own rules and regulations. Now bringing cultures together from different countries a year in advance when you don't know what is going to happen in the next 30-45 days, from a pandemic point of view, was the biggest challenge,” he added. 

Property has grown over the years 

As per Mashruwala, Supersonic has grown in the style of music and it has also grown from an EDM and techno festival to a multi-genre music festival. 

“We have added some fantastic experiences and in 2020 we just tried our hand at that and saw that the feedback was amazing. So, the festival has grown into a multi-genre music and lifestyle festival and also has mini-festivals within the festivals itself,” he added.

In addition to the brands on-boarded, Vh1 Supersonic 2023 has also tied up with Ajio as the fashion partner.

Marketing of the property 

“We market the festival as a digital-first property. So, all our marketing efforts are primarily digital. Along with that, because we are an experiential festival, we have partnered with a whole bunch of outlets that have a similar vibe to ours. For example, you will see our marketing in all Impresario clubs, restaurants, and bars across the country because their ethos on music and lifestyle matches ours. We have also partnered with JCB, they have a big say in the fashion and beauty space,” Mashruwala said.

Audience’s response as Vh1 Supersonic returns after three years

Mashruwala said that Supersonic has always had a loyal fanbase and the moment Vh1 Supersonic edition 2023 was announced, they saw an explosion from their fanbase saying they are so happy to have it back. 

“Along with that, the moment we announced all our new experiences, we saw a whole vast variety of people who want to visit Vh1 Supersonic now. In terms of response, in the last three months it's been fantastic,” Mashruwala added.

“The way we have been working on the ticket pricing has been such that it becomes accessible to everyone who would like to enjoy the festival,” Mashruwala said. 

The ticket prices begin from Rs 999 for Day 1 to Rs 4,999 for the VIP for Day 3. Three-day and weekend passes for the event are also being made available.
